Novel Anti-HIV CAR-T Cell Therapy Shows Promise for Durable Viral Control in Early Clinical Trial

Caring Cross (搜索) announced promising early clinical data from a first-in-human Phase I/IIa trial evaluating a novel anti-HIV (搜索) CAR-T cell therapy that demonstrated sustained viral control in select participants. The findings, presented at the American Society of Gene and Cell Therapy Annual Meeting in Boston, suggest the potential for durable immune-mediated HIV suppression without continuous antiretroviral therapy (搜索).
Clinical Trial Design and Participants
The dose-escalation study evaluated the safety and preliminary efficacy of an anti-HIV (搜索) duoCAR-T (搜索) therapy in nine ART-suppressed individuals. The treatment uses participants' own T cells (搜索), which are genetically engineered using Caring Cross (搜索)'s proprietary duoCAR technology before reinfusion.
The study included three distinct cohorts with varying treatment approaches. Cohort 1 received no conditioning regimen, while Cohorts 2 and 3 received mild, non-myeloablative conditioning followed three days later by low-dose or high-dose cell infusions, respectively.
Sustained Viral Control Achieved
Among the six participants in Cohorts 2 and 3, two individuals maintained undetectable to very low viral loads after stopping antiretroviral therapy (搜索) - one for nearly a year and another for nearly two years. A third participant achieved transient control for nearly three months.
"Although the primary focus of the study was safety, a few participants experienced better-than-expected outcomes following interruption of antiretroviral therapy (搜索). We are particularly interested in two individuals who have maintained control of HIV (搜索) with undetectable viral loads for extended periods," said Dr. Steven Deeks, Professor of Medicine at UCSF and principal investigator.
Dr. Mehrdad Abedi, Professor of Medicine and Director of the Alpha Stem Cell Clinic at UC Davis (搜索), noted the significance of the consecutive responses: "While this level of viral control can rarely occur in the absence of intervention, the depth of viral suppression observed after our clinical trial in two consecutive patients in the conditioning arm is especially compelling."
Early Treatment Initiation Key Factor
All three participants who achieved sustained or transient viral control had initiated antiretroviral drugs early in the course of their infection. This timing appears crucial for therapeutic success, as early ART initiation may limit the size and distribution of the viral reservoir, potentially enabling more effective CAR-T cell-mediated control.
Several participants who did not achieve sustained control still demonstrated delayed viral rebound compared to typical kinetics, suggesting some degree of immune-mediated suppression even in partial responders.
Safety Profile
The therapy demonstrated a favorable safety profile, with no serious adverse events attributed to the duoCAR-T (搜索) cell product itself. One participant experienced a drop in blood counts related to the bone marrow conditioning regimen, but this was manageable and expected.
In Cohort 1, where no conditioning was used, no detectable CAR-T cells (搜索) were found in the blood after infusion, and all three participants experienced rapid viral rebound after stopping antiretroviral drugs, highlighting the importance of conditioning regimens for therapeutic efficacy.
Addressing Global HIV Burden
The research addresses a critical unmet medical need, as HIV (搜索) continues to affect approximately 37 million people globally. Despite antiretroviral therapy (搜索) transforming HIV into a manageable chronic condition, it requires lifelong treatment and faces challenges including an estimated 1.3 million new infections annually and more than 700,000 HIV-related deaths each year.
"This work represents the culmination of years of scientific and clinical effort to develop a therapy that harnesses the body's own immune cells to fight HIV (搜索)," said Dr. Boro Dropulić, Founder and Executive Director of Caring Cross (搜索). "While the clinical data are encouraging, the vector used to generate the anti-HIV duoCAR-T (搜索) cells reflects a first-generation design — an important step toward a definitive therapeutic solution."
Future Development
The trial continues with plans to explore modifications such as adjusting the timing of ART interruption or administering multiple infusions to improve outcomes. Caring Cross (搜索) has already advanced next-generation versions expected to enhance the potency and durability of the anti-HIV (搜索) response.
The study received funding from the California Institute for Regenerative Medicine (搜索) (CIRM) under Grant Number CLIN2-12090. The research team includes investigators from UCSF, UC Davis (搜索), and Case Western Reserve University, with manufacturing support from Vector BioMed (搜索).
